Can I withdraw the bonus immediately?

No. You have to wager it first. Usually 35x the bonus amount. So a £10 bonus needs £350 in bets. Sounds harsh, but slots count 100%, so it goes fast. Avoid blackjack or roulette if you have a bonus active, they count like 10%.

The Fine Print Nobody Reads (But You Should)

I hate this section too. But skipping it costs you money. Here are the key traps:

  • Wagering timeline: Some bonuses expire in 72 hours. That’s tight. Look for ones that give you 7-30 days.
  • Max bet limit: You can’t bet more than £5 per spin while wagering a bonus. Bet higher, and they void your winnings.
  • Game restrictions: Some slots are excluded. Live dealer games are almost always excluded.
  • Max cashout: This is a big one. A bonus might give you £100 free, but cap your winnings at £150. Anything over is forfeited. 888 Casino does this on some offers.
